目前位置:首頁(yè) > 科技文章 > 每日程式設(shè)計(jì) > css知識(shí)
-
- 使用CSS實(shí)施自定義滾動(dòng)條
- 要在Chrome和Edge中設(shè)置自定義滾動(dòng)條樣式,使用::-webkit-scrollbar偽元素;在Firefox中則使用scrollbar-width和scrollbar-color屬性。 1.對(duì)於Webkit瀏覽器,通過(guò)定義::-webkit-scrollbar設(shè)置滾動(dòng)條整體寬度,::-webkit-scrollbar-track設(shè)置軌道樣式,::-webkit-scrollbar-thumb設(shè)置滑塊樣式;2.對(duì)於Firefox,使用scrollbar-width控制滾動(dòng)條寬度,scroll
- css教學(xué) . web前端 1008 2025-07-07 02:03:30
-
- 創(chuàng)建有效的CSS打印樣式表
- 給網(wǎng)頁(yè)加打印樣式有必要,因?yàn)榧垙埮c屏幕顯示特性不同,直接打印易出現(xiàn)排版錯(cuò)亂等問(wèn)題。 1.使用@mediaprint定義打印專用樣式,可隱藏?zé)o關(guān)元素、移除背景並調(diào)整字體;2.通過(guò)偽元素顯示超鏈接地址,提升可讀性;3.控制分頁(yè)與佈局,避免內(nèi)容斷裂並設(shè)置合適邊距;4.利用瀏覽器開發(fā)者工具模擬打印環(huán)境進(jìn)行調(diào)試,確保輸出整潔易讀。
- css教學(xué) . web前端 557 2025-07-07 01:59:40
-
- 使用CSS創(chuàng)建響應(yīng)式表
- 響應(yīng)式表格可通過(guò)三種方法實(shí)現(xiàn)首先使用媒體查詢調(diào)整佈局將表格結(jié)構(gòu)改為垂直顯示並用data-label標(biāo)註數(shù)據(jù)類型其次通過(guò)overflow-x實(shí)現(xiàn)橫向滾動(dòng)適合內(nèi)容多無(wú)需重排的情況最後結(jié)合前端框架如Bootstrap的.table-responsive類簡(jiǎn)化開發(fā)且兼容性好根據(jù)項(xiàng)目需求選擇合適方法即可
- css教學(xué) . web前端 593 2025-07-07 01:58:40
-
- 用純CS創(chuàng)建工具提示
- 用純CSS實(shí)現(xiàn)tooltip的方法是:1.使用嵌套的HTML結(jié)構(gòu),包裹觸發(fā)區(qū)域和提示內(nèi)容;2.通過(guò):hover控制子元素顯示隱藏;3.利用絕對(duì)定位設(shè)置提示框位置;4.添加動(dòng)畫提升體驗(yàn);5.注意z-index和多方向適配。具體實(shí)現(xiàn)包括設(shè)置.tooltip為相對(duì)定位,.tooltiptext默認(rèn)隱藏,在hover時(shí)變?yōu)榭梢?,並可加入transition實(shí)現(xiàn)淡入和延遲效果,同時(shí)通過(guò)類名控制不同方向的定位,但需注意移動(dòng)端hover效果可能受限。
- css教學(xué) . web前端 217 2025-07-07 01:53:51
-
- 控制CSS變量範(fàn)圍和後備
- 控制CSS變量作用域可避免命名衝突並提升維護(hù)性。 1.將變量定義在具體父元素而非:root中,如.button{--btn-bg:#007bff;},限制變量?jī)H作用於該組件及其子元素;2.使用fallback值確保變量未定義時(shí)有默認(rèn)替代,如color:var(--text-color,#333);3.利用嵌套優(yōu)先級(jí)實(shí)現(xiàn)樣式覆蓋,如.card.dark內(nèi)部重定義--bg並結(jié)合命名規(guī)範(fàn)減少衝突可能,從而提升樣式的靈活性與穩(wěn)定性。
- css教學(xué) . web前端 291 2025-07-07 01:51:11
-
- 解決CSS瀏覽器兼容性問(wèn)題和前綴
- 處理CSS瀏覽器兼容性和前綴問(wèn)題需理解瀏覽器支持差異並合理使用廠商前綴。 1.了解常見問(wèn)題如Flexbox、Grid支持不一,position:sticky失效,動(dòng)畫表現(xiàn)不同;2.查閱CanIuse確認(rèn)特性支持情況;3.正確使用-webkit-、-moz-、-ms-、-o-等廠商前綴;4.推薦使用Autoprefixer自動(dòng)添加前綴;5.安裝PostCSS並配置browserslist指定目標(biāo)瀏覽器;6.構(gòu)建時(shí)自動(dòng)處理兼容性;7.老項(xiàng)目可用Modernizr檢測(cè)特性;8.不必追求所有瀏覽器一致,確
- css教學(xué) . web前端 245 2025-07-07 01:44:21
-
- 使用CSS進(jìn)行更好演示的造型表
- 要美化網(wǎng)頁(yè)表格,首先使用邊框和間距提升清晰度,通過(guò)border-collapse合併邊框,設(shè)置統(tǒng)一padding和淺灰邊框;其次添加懸停效果增強(qiáng)交互體驗(yàn),使用tr:hover改變背景色;接著區(qū)分錶頭與內(nèi)容,為th設(shè)置背景色和左對(duì)齊;最後讓表格在小屏幕友好顯示,通過(guò)div容器添加水平滾動(dòng)條實(shí)現(xiàn)響應(yīng)式佈局。
- css教學(xué) . web前端 179 2025-07-07 01:30:30
-
- 使用 @font-face CSS規(guī)則實(shí)現(xiàn)自定義Web字體
- 使用@font-face加載自定義字體需注意語(yǔ)法、格式兼容和性能優(yōu)化。 1.正確寫法包括指定字體名稱、多格式路徑(如woff2、woff)、設(shè)置font-weight和font-style,並使用相對(duì)路徑或CDN;2.優(yōu)先選擇woff2格式,其次woff,可通過(guò)工具轉(zhuǎn)換字體格式;3.性能方面應(yīng)限製字符集與變體數(shù)量,使用font-display:swap避免空白文本;4.自託管可提升控制力與隱私保護(hù),但需自行處理文件配置與服務(wù)器MIME類型支持。
- css教學(xué) . web前端 868 2025-07-07 01:29:50
-
- 高級(jí)CSS懸停效應(yīng)教程
- CSS的hover效果可通過(guò)多種技巧增強(qiáng)交互質(zhì)感。 1.使用transition實(shí)現(xiàn)平滑動(dòng)畫,控制顏色、大小、位置的變化過(guò)程,提升自然感;2.結(jié)合偽元素(::before或::after)創(chuàng)建遮罩或掃光效果,豐富視覺(jué)反饋;3.組合transform與filter,實(shí)現(xiàn)圖片放大、對(duì)比度變化及陰影等動(dòng)態(tài)效果;4.注意移動(dòng)端兼容性問(wèn)題,避免依賴hover顯示關(guān)鍵信息,可考慮JavaScript或替代交互方案。
- css教學(xué) . web前端 989 2025-07-07 01:29:31
-
- 使用CSS Z-Index屬性管理堆疊上下文
- z-index的問(wèn)題常源於層疊上下文理解不足。 1.z-index僅在同一個(gè)層疊上下文中有效,父容器層級(jí)決定子元素上限;2.創(chuàng)建新層疊上下文的方式包括設(shè)置非static的position、非auto的z-index、transform、filter等屬性;3.彈窗被遮擋可能是因父容器創(chuàng)建了獨(dú)立上下文,應(yīng)將其掛載到更高層級(jí);4.多個(gè)組件處?kù)恫煌舷挛臅r(shí),需統(tǒng)一規(guī)劃層級(jí)範(fàn)圍並用CSS變量管理;5.排查問(wèn)題可通過(guò)開發(fā)者工具查看computed樣式與臨時(shí)添加視覺(jué)標(biāo)識(shí)輔助判斷。
- css教學(xué) . web前端 702 2025-07-07 01:25:30
-
- CSS造型表和輸入的教程
- ProperlystylingformsandinputswithCSSenhancesusabilityandprofessionalism.Beginbyresettingdefaultbrowserstylesforconsistentappearanceacrosselementsliketextfields,dropdowns,checkboxes,andbuttonsusingborder,padding,font-size,andborder-radius.Applywidth:1
- css教學(xué) . web前端 152 2025-07-07 01:24:31
-
- 有效利用CSS媒體查詢來(lái)響應(yīng)
- Media QueratiesIncsSolawerSignbyEpplyingStyleSbaseDevicecharacteristics.1.StartwithMobile-firstapphack,寫作Basestybasestyforsmallsmallscreensandenhancingthemforlargerdevices.2.usecommonbrebtlybra地上,以下
- css教學(xué) . web前端 460 2025-07-07 01:19:51
-
- 在CSS中實(shí)施圖像和視頻的對(duì)象擬合屬性
- object-fit屬性通過(guò)控製圖片和視頻在容器中的縮放行為來(lái)防止變形。其核心值包括contain(保持比例適應(yīng)容器)、cover(覆蓋容器並裁剪多餘部分)、fill(拉伸填充容器)、none(保持原尺寸)和scale-down(取none與contain較小者)。對(duì)於圖片,使用object-fit:cover;可確保不同尺寸圖片在固定佈局中一致顯示;對(duì)視頻,該屬性同樣適用,如用於視頻聊天UI或背景視頻時(shí)填滿容器而不拉伸。瀏覽器支持方面,現(xiàn)代瀏覽器均支持,但I(xiàn)E11不兼容,需用polyfill或
- css教學(xué) . web前端 351 2025-07-07 01:14:42
-
- 將CSS邊框圖像應(yīng)用於復(fù)雜邊界
- theBorder-imagecsspropertyAllowScomplexBorderSingimagesBysigingTheminTosections.1.itdividesanimageInmageIntonininePartslikeatic-tac-tac-tac-tac-tac-tac-tac-tac-taCegrid,seepcornersfixedgixedgessedgesstretchorrepeat.2.thesyntaxincludessource.2.theSyntaxincludessource
- css教學(xué) . web前端 412 2025-07-07 00:58:01
工具推薦

